Aurora the Cat needs a home


I’ve been waiting for my forever home since February 2015.





Pale, saucer-like eyes, whiskers long and white, and a heart-shaped face designed to melt hearts completes her breathtaking beauty. Aurora's full of personality and isn't afraid to let you know how she feels. Although, her bold characteristics seem to be tamed when in the presence of understanding children. In true kitty cat fashion, Aurora is endlessly curious. She loves nothing more than to follow her pert little nose and explore her surroundings, then claim the best perch for herself. What would make this beauty happiest, though, is a perch inside a home to call hers always. 



After several years at the shelter, Aurora was taken into foster care for a break. She is much happier not being around other cats! Her foster mom has two small dogs, which Aurora doesn't seem to mind much at all. Aurora also doesn't mind being around a rowdy four-year-old boy. She does enjoy being pet a lot more now, but still on her own terms (she is the queen, after all).



 




This kitty is currently in foster care.



Adoption Package




The list below includes all of the basic services that each of our cats receives:





  • Spay/Neuter surgery


  • Feline Leukemia/FIV combo test


  • Microchip with free lifetime registration


  • Rabies vaccination


  • FVRCP (Feline distemper) vaccinations; complete series


  • Bordetella vaccination


  • De-worming treatments


  • Flea treatment


  • Full senior blood panel for cats 8+ years of age


  • Starter cat/kitten food


  • Behavioral assessment


  • A continuing resource to answer any of your questions or concerns





Our adoption fee helps to offset the services that we provide for your newest furry addition. It also acts as a donation to help support our organization as a whole, allowing us to continue our efforts to rescue and re-home cats in need of our help.

As a no-kill rescue, we can only bring in and save more cats and kittens in need as our current cats and kittens are adopted. This is why we say that when you adopt one cat or kitten you are actually saving TWO lives! One is the current cat or kitten that you are adopting, the second is the one that we now have room to save and place into our safe shelter.
